云计算工程技术人员通过分布式协作、自动化工具和持续迭代的工作模式,构建高效可靠的云服务体系。其核心在于多角色协同开发、DevOps一体化流程和智能化运维监控,确保云平台的稳定性与安全性。
-
分布式团队协作
云计算工程团队通常由架构师、开发工程师、运维专家和安全顾问组成,采用敏捷开发模式。例如,架构师设计弹性伸缩的云基础设施,开发人员通过微服务拆分功能模块,安全团队则同步实施数据加密和访问控制策略。这种协作模式依赖实时沟通工具(如Slack、Jira)和版本控制系统(如Git),实现跨地域的高效协同。 -
DevOps与自动化驱动
工作流程高度依赖CI/CD(持续集成/持续部署)工具链。通过Jenkins、Kubernetes等平台,代码提交后自动触发测试、打包和部署,将传统数周的发布周期缩短至小时级。例如,某电商平台通过Terraform脚本实现云资源的“一键扩缩容”,应对流量高峰时自动调配计算资源。 -
智能化运维与实时响应
运维人员利用Prometheus、Grafana等工具监控云服务的CPU负载、延迟等指标,结合AI算法预测故障。当系统异常时,自动化脚本优先尝试修复,同时通知人工介入。某金融云案例显示,智能运维系统将故障恢复时间从40分钟降至5分钟以内。 -
安全与合规性嵌入全流程
从代码开发阶段即引入安全扫描工具(如SonarQube),部署时强制合规检查(如ISO 27001标准)。技术人员需定期演练数据备份恢复,并通过渗透测试验证防御体系。例如,医疗云平台通过动态令牌和零信任架构,确保患者数据的全程加密传输。
云计算工程师需持续学习新技术(如Serverless、边缘计算),同时平衡效率与风险。企业应重视团队技能培训,并建立跨部门的知识共享机制,以应对快速演进的云生态挑战。